this is just larry klayman re-filing a case that has already lost. klayman's claim is that a person needs both parents to be US citizens to qualify as a "natural born citizen". this argument has been soundly rejected by the court multiple times.
from ankeny v daniels:
"Based upon the language of Article II, Section 1, Clause 4 and the guidance provided by Wong Kim Ark, we conclude that persons born within the borders of the United States are "natural born Citizens" for Article II, Section 1 purposes, regardless of the citizenship of their parents."
